#c19412 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#c19412 is composed of 75.7% red, 58% green and 7.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 23.3% magenta, 90.7% yellow and 24.3% black. It has a hue angle of 44.6 degrees, a saturation of 82.9% and a lightness of 41.4%. #c19412 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ffff24 with #832900. Closest websafe color is: #cc9900.

Shades and Tints of #c19412

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0e0a01 is the darkest color, while #fffefb is the lightest one.

Tones of #c19412

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#706d63 is the less saturated color, while #d19c02 is the most saturated one.
